Today, the third season of the hit animated series, “The Great North”, arrived on Disney+ in the United Kingdom and Ireland, with the first three episodes being released and new episodes set to be released weekly.

Follow the Alaskan adventures of the Tobin family, as a single dad, Beef, does his best to keep his weird bunch of kids close – especially his only daughter, Judy, whose artistic dreams lead her away from the family fishing boat and into the glamorous world of the local mall. Rounding out the family are Judy’s older brother, Wolf, and his fiancé, Honeybee, her middle brother, Ham, and ten-year-old-going-on-fifty little brother, Moon. While their mother is not in the picture, Judy seeks guidance from her new boss, Alyson, and her imaginary friend, Alanis Morissette, who appears to her in the northern lights.

“The Great North” is a 20th Television production. The series is created and written by executive producers Wendy Molyneux, Lizzie Molyneux-Logelin and Minty Lewis. Wendy and Lizzie Molyneux serve as showrunners, and BOB’S BURGERS creator Loren Bouchard also serves as executive producer. Animation is produced through Bento Box Entertainment.

The third season debuted on the FOX channel and Hulu in the United States in September, with new episodes being released weekly until a mid-season break. Currently, it’s unknown how many episodes are in the third season.

The first two seasons of “The Great North” are also available to stream now on Disney+ in the UK and Ireland.
